What Are Lumineers?

Lumineers® are very thin porcelain shells that bond to your teeth, covering their visible area, similar to dental veneers. They help with various cosmetic dental issues such as:

  • Gaps between teeth
  • Misaligned or misshapen teeth
  • Stained or discolored teeth
  • Chipped, cracked, or broken teeth

Uneven teeth or gums

Lumineers vs. Dental Veneers

While Lumineers can help with the same issues as dental veneers, they are less invasive and do not require the dentist to alter your teeth. Dental veneers require removing a bit of a tooth’s enamel to make space for the veneer. Lumineers are so thin that this removal of enamel is not necessary.

Lumineers are more comfortable, quicker to place, and reversible if needed, making them the perfect choice for Shenandoah Family Dentistry patients. Other benefits of Lumineers include:

  • Long-lasting: Lumineers® can last over 20 years
  • Less invasive: Lunineers® requires no drilling or removal of tooth enamel
  • Flexible: Lumineers® are installed one at a time and only on the teeth that need them
  • Beautiful: Lumineers® provide you with a beautiful, white smile
  • Reversible: Shenandoah Family Dentistry can easily remove Lumineers® if the need arises
  • Painless: The installation and wearing of Lumineers® is free of pain and discomfort
  • Durable: Though thinner than porcelain veneers, Lumineers® are Cerinate® porcelain, which is stronger and less likely to chip or crack

Lumineers Application

During your first visit to Shenandoah Family Dentistry, the dentist will take X-rays and bite impressions to determine how your teeth fit together. They also perform a full oral exam to check for any tooth decay or gum disease. After the dentist chooses the perfect color to match your teeth, your impressions head to the lab.

On your second visit to our office, the dentist will bond the Lumineers® to your teeth using a unique bonding substance. After a quick cleaning and polishing of your teeth, the dentist will remove the Lumineers from their holders, and you can leave the office with a beautiful, healthy smile.

Once you are home, you should eat a soft diet for 24-48 hours and continue to brush and floss like you normally would.
